This space is excellent for anyone that needs a legit and beautiful looking recording studio for film or photo work. It is a fully functional and operating studio hidden away in the hip and central North Park area of San Diego. The studio is in walking distance from many of North Park's wonderful restaurants, bars, breweries, and shops. One or two cars can park in the driveway and the rest should easily find parking on the street nearby. The main space is 765 sqft in total, split up about evenly between a control room and live room. There are also two small soundlocks that can double as "isobooths" and a converted garage that functions as a lounge or green room (complete with full bath, kitchenette, couch, TV, video games, etc.). The garage is not part of the 765 sqft. The studio and garage/lounge are both air-conditioned and feature dimmable lighting as well as access to outside light. Behind the studio is a lovely outdoor patio with seating and shade. The look of the studio is a combination of 1970's and mid-century modern touches. The color scheme includes dark stained wood, deep reds, burnt oranges, browns/tans, and creams. It's a very warm and inviting space filled with recording gear and instruments, but not cluttered. The lounge space has a unique coffee table with circuit board inlay and retro modern lamps. Records done at the studio adorn the lounge walls. The studio can also, obviously, be booked to record music or voice for an additional charge. It also makes for an excellent mix room or mastering facility. The studio was designed by world renowned studio designer, Wes Lachot and features a 32 channel Neve Genesys mixing console, tons of outboard gear, a plethora of new and vintage microphones, and a wide-assortment of instruments including a baby grand piano, Hammond organ, Fender Rhodes, and more.
